I don't know about Vista --- but for Windows Xp try the following: Click out of the Auto setup by click "cancel" Open game folder My Computer --> CD Drive D --> Right Click --> Open __ Setup.exe properties Windows 98 --> last two --apply ok -- Double click on Setup.exe Choose Windows 98 error message: Windows Media Player 7 -- cancel Restart your system and remember to shut down all extra programs once again. Go to game folder --- Nautilis for both the installation file and the .exe file. -- Properties Windows 98 --- and also check the last two boxes -- Click Appy - Click OK. Apply Patch Nat_PATCH_2.4,exe to C:\Program Files\DreamCatcher\Nautilus You will also need the Codecs for Windows Media 8 -- download and then install them as "add" and not "replace". http://www.microsoft.com/downloads/detai...;DisplayLang=enNext change your video acceleration and Audio Acceleration to at least two notches to the left (you may need more or less depending on your system's configuration.) inferno

Here's how I was able to make Nautilus run on XP.Followed nearly all of your suggestions.Anyway,here goes: 1)Cancel auto run,turn off my av & firewall 2)Opened Nautilus disc-my computer,E drive,right click,open 3)Right click on setup,click on properties.run in compatibliity mode with Windows 98/ME,click apply,then ok. 4)Launched setup,click on Windows 98,ran setup 5)Error message for WMP 7, click cancel. 6)Downloaded WMP 8 codecs,per your link. 7)Restart computer 8)Installed WMP 8 codecs,checked 2nd box (add) 9)Launched the game.And.... It Worked!! I didn't have to turn down my audio & video acceleration at all, but others may have to.I immediately saved my game after it started.Not sure what patch you meant, couldn't find it anyhow.To quote a famous cartoon character, "that's all folks!!" As many people have stated The Mystery Of The Nautilus has some serious issues when the game tries to play the game videos in the game. I tried at least seven times to get Nautilus to run. Well after alot of trial and error and using the suggestions on this website I set everything to Windows 2000 compatibility (98 would freeze installer) and checked the last two check boxes as has also been stated here. So I ran the game Nautilus and I had subtitles enabled. The narator would say :"The seas..." and then game would freeze.
I exited out of the game and got to thinking. Since I skip the animated logos at the very begining of the game by hitting the escape key. Could I also do the same for the beginning movie?
Well I decided to give it a try. I relaunched the game and tried hitting escape before the narrator finished "The Seas" where the game had froze before. I Hit escape as soon as he said the word "The". And it worked!!!!! Since then I have not had a single in game video problem.
On a side note I believe it would be best to let you all know I have Vista(shudders).

I have just uninstalled Nautilus from my PC, and reinstalled it in XP. No messing about with compatibility modes, no adjusting audio and video accelerations, no trying to find WMP 7.1, no downloading of codecs, and with AVG still running. And when I hit the 'play' icon the game seems to freeze, but when I hit 'Escape', away I go, into the decompression chamber!!
Would be nice to know if other folk have the same success.
